I know what you're saying, the restrictions are frustrating especially if you've better equipment in the pool. Unfortunately, the restrictions are historical. Tigers didn't go into Pz Division battalions, they went into independent battalions, it was the Panthers that went to the Pz Divisions, and light tank destroyers were handled differently than heavy tank destroyers.

The problem with Stugs is a problem they've discussed on the beta team, the massive numbers of Stugs will hopefully be addressed, before the last update version.

Use editwir to change into tigers.
I,II,III,V SS Panzerdiv(Pzgren-43)hade the 8th panzer company whit tigers until 101,102 and later 103rd SS Hvy pzbat. was formed.
Later Pzdiv G.D had a thrid bat.whit tigers.
